I have a 2015 R-Pod 178 with a 13,500 btu air conditioner. I also have a Yamaha 2000 inverter that I would like to use to power the a/c. I have read many many posts on many websites about using a Supco Spp6 Super Boost (Hard Start Kit Positive Temperature Coefficient (PTC) Relay and Start Capacitor SPP Series) to start and run a 13,500 a/c. The posts will tell you three ways to use it. (1) piggyback the SPP6 to the start capacitor, or (2) replace the start capacitor with the SPP6, or (3) connect SPP6 the "run start" capacitor. Well I have tried all three configurations and none of them worked. Yet I have read posts (40%) that say it starts and runs the 13.5 a/c works using a Honda 2000 or Yamaha 2000 inverter and (60%) say that it will not start and run a 13.5 a/c. This is my post that says a Yamaha 2000 inverter will not start and run a 13,500 Dometic A/C.

It's kind of rare to get one to start and run on a 2000 watt, often it has as much to do with altitude and outside temps as anything else. If you have found a single 2K won't start and run yours, then it's time to buy a second 2K and connect them. That WILL work.
BTW.. you should state a single 2K won't run YOURS, as obviously, many owners can and do. Our pod in fact would. |

One caveat on getting a second generator. The first one and the second one have to both be parallel capable in order to do this. The Generac iX2000 I have is not parallel capable. However, at least at home it will start and run the AC. I don't know how well it would do in hot weather or at any significant altitude though. We are only about 300 ft. above sea level where we live.
I tried installing a hard start capacitor also. As soon as the AC compressor tried to start, it threw the generator into overload. ![]() ![]() |

Something else to try is full synthetic oil. But even if you get it to work at 80F in your driveway at sea level, go to a higher elevation and/or higher temperature and you'll lose so much engine power (and get a higher pressure in the A/C) that it won't work. I had no problems running my pod's A/C with a Yamaha 2400 but I was always worried I would hit the limit somewhere.
